Companion Website Title: Theory and Design for Mechanical MeasurementsAuthor: Richard Figliola, Donald BeasleyPublisher: Wiley ISBN: 0-471-44593-2 Publication Date: October 2005 Description: The fourth edition of this text provides a fundamental treatment for developing, operating, and analyzing measurement systems and for reporting results. It features a unified thread the roles of statistics and uncertainty analysis in developing test plans, selecting systems, anticipating the quality of results, and reporting results. The text also includes a thorough discussion of sampling concepts and data acquisition system and signal conditioning methods. Title: Digital Signal Processing with the C6713 and C6416 DSKAuthor: Rulph ChassaingPublisher: John Wiley ISBN: 0-471-69007-4 Publication Date: 11/19/2004 Description: With this text, electrical and computer engineering students can grasp and apply the principles of digital signal processing (DSP) through real-time implementation of experiments and projects. The book includes 105 programming examples, a chapter on DSP/BIOS and real-time data exchange (RTDX), as well as student projects that cover a wide variety of applications including filtering, spectrum analysis, modulation techniques, and speech processing. It also features information on using RTDX with the NI LabVIEW DSP Test Integration Toolkit.
